4 IN 5 BACK MEDICAL POT USE

SANTA FE - Nearly four in five New Mexicans support Gov. Gary
Johnson's proposal to legalize the medical use of marijuana,
according to a poll released Saturday by a group backing drug law
changes.

The poll also found generally broad support across the political
spectrum for Johnson's other proposals to revamp the state's drug
laws, including the decriminalization of possession of small amounts
of marijuana.

Sen. Cisco McSorley, D-Albuquerque, said the poll showed 'the people
are ahead of the politicians' in favoring an overhaul of drug policies.

The poll was commissioned by the Lindesmith Center-Drug Policy
Foundation, a research group and key supporter of Johnson's efforts
to change drug laws.
